Responsibilities

  • Gather documents, prepare the workstation and ensure that changes have been incorporate prior to inspection.
  • Utilize the drawings and specifications to plan all but the most complex company product inspections.
  • Suggest and incorporate improvements for plans personally developed.
  • Evaluate parts to ensure that they meet the specified requirements per the inspection plans.
  • Perform simple CMM and manual inspections with limited supervision.
  • Perform and train others on all company documentation requirements with limited supervision.
  • Provide floor/on machine inspection support. Develop working knowledge on machine process to utilize during inspection.
  • Identify handling concerns then suggest and implements solutions.
  • Select the appropriate qualification tool needed for the job and verify that it is calibrated and in good working condition.
  • Competently and safely inspect the part using hand tools in a manner that ensures repeatability and reproducibility of the measurement.
  • Locate the program and verifies the accuracy of the program for a CMM inspections.
  • Competently and safely performs simple manual CMM inspections.
  • Properly sets up and breaks down the setups on the CMM safely.
  • Confirm that results with a risk of falling outside the measurement uncertainty as applicable by utilizing alternate methods and/or inspectors.
  • Complete the inspection step on the router to properly indicate pass/fail and note the time to ensure the inspection results are traceability to the appropriate inspector.
  • Package the part to ensure the quality of the part and safety to personnel is maintained.
  • Properly tag all non-conforming parts as out of specification and place them in the Material Review Board (MRB) cage
  • Document the defect/out of specification condition on the Material Review Report (MRR) and submit the report for review and disposition determination.
  • Able to process dispositions with limited supervision.
  • Sign the disposition identified by MRB on the MRR and properly process the part per the instruction.
